Very Good condition, 7,5/10, Made in USA, including original tweed hardcase with case candy and COA (which reads 1950 Telecaster, what is that?) dated Jan 1997, blonde finish with gold hardware, some dings in the white pickguard, no fret wear in the birdseye maple neck, more info: Brass saddles as standard. They were an approximation of what the CS thought a 50's Tele should be/was.They weren't in any way made to be 'vintage correct'.They only made them from 1996 to 1998 when Eldred took over and the catalog line changed and the Time Machine series in NOS/CC were introduced.
